// Copyright 2019 The Chromium Authors
// Use of this source code is governed by a BSD-style license that can be
// found in the LICENSE file.
#include "base/test/metrics/histogram_tester.h"
#include "testing/gtest/include/gtest/gtest.h"
#include "content/browser/background_sync/background_sync_metrics.h"
#include "third_party/blink/public/mojom/background_sync/background_sync.mojom.h"
namespace content {
using blink::mojom::BackgroundSyncType;
class BackgroundSyncMetricsTest : public ::testing::Test {
public:
BackgroundSyncMetricsTest() = default;
BackgroundSyncMetricsTest(const BackgroundSyncMetricsTest&) = delete;
BackgroundSyncMetricsTest& operator=(const BackgroundSyncMetricsTest&) =
delete;
~BackgroundSyncMetricsTest() override = default;
protected:
base::HistogramTester histogram_tester_;
};
TEST_F(BackgroundSyncMetricsTest, RecordEventStarted) {
BackgroundSyncMetrics::RecordEventStarted(BackgroundSyncType::ONE_SHOT,
/* started_in_foreground= */ false);
histogram_tester_.ExpectBucketCount(
"BackgroundSync.Event.OneShotStartedInForeground", false, 1);
BackgroundSyncMetrics::RecordEventStarted(BackgroundSyncType::PERIODIC,
/* started_in_foreground= */ true);
histogram_tester_.ExpectBucketCount(
"BackgroundSync.Event.PeriodicStartedInForeground", true, 1);
}
TEST_F(BackgroundSyncMetricsTest, RecordRegistrationComplete) {
BackgroundSyncMetrics::RecordRegistrationComplete(
/* event_succeeded= */ true, /* num_attempts_required= */ 3);
histogram_tester_.ExpectBucketCount(
"BackgroundSync.Registration.OneShot.EventSucceededAtCompletion", true,
1);
histogram_tester_.ExpectBucketCount(
"BackgroundSync.Registration.OneShot.NumAttemptsForSuccessfulEvent", 3,
1);
}
TEST_F(BackgroundSyncMetricsTest, RecordEventResult) {
BackgroundSyncMetrics::RecordEventResult(BackgroundSyncType::ONE_SHOT,
/* event_succeeded= */ true,
/* finished_in_foreground= */ true);
histogram_tester_.ExpectBucketCount(
"BackgroundSync.Event.OneShotResultPattern",
BackgroundSyncMetrics::ResultPattern::RESULT_PATTERN_SUCCESS_FOREGROUND,
1);
BackgroundSyncMetrics::RecordEventResult(BackgroundSyncType::PERIODIC,
/* event_succeeded= */ false,
/* finished_in_foreground= */ false);
histogram_tester_.ExpectBucketCount(
"BackgroundSync.Event.PeriodicResultPattern",
BackgroundSyncMetrics::ResultPattern::RESULT_PATTERN_FAILED_BACKGROUND,
1);
}
TEST_F(BackgroundSyncMetricsTest, RecordBatchSyncEventComplete) {
BackgroundSyncMetrics::RecordBatchSyncEventComplete(
BackgroundSyncType::ONE_SHOT, base::Seconds(1),
/* from_wakeup_task= */ false,
/* number_of_batched_sync_events= */ 1);
histogram_tester_.ExpectUniqueSample("BackgroundSync.Event.Time",
base::Seconds(1).InMilliseconds(), 1);
BackgroundSyncMetrics::RecordBatchSyncEventComplete(
BackgroundSyncType::PERIODIC, base::Minutes(1),
/* from_wakeup_task= */ false,
/* number_of_batched_sync_events= */ 10);
histogram_tester_.ExpectUniqueSample("PeriodicBackgroundSync.Event.Time",
base::Minutes(1).InMilliseconds(), 1);
}
TEST_F(BackgroundSyncMetricsTest, CountRegisterSuccess) {
BackgroundSyncMetrics::CountRegisterSuccess(
BackgroundSyncType::ONE_SHOT,
/* min_interval_ms= */ -1, BackgroundSyncMetrics::REGISTRATION_COULD_FIRE,
/* registration_is_duplicate= */
BackgroundSyncMetrics::REGISTRATION_IS_NOT_DUPLICATE);
histogram_tester_.ExpectUniqueSample(
"BackgroundSync.Registration.OneShot.CouldFire", 1, 1);
histogram_tester_.ExpectUniqueSample("BackgroundSync.Registration.OneShot",
BACKGROUND_SYNC_STATUS_OK, 1);
histogram_tester_.ExpectUniqueSample(
"BackgroundSync.Registration.OneShot.IsDuplicate", 0, 1);
BackgroundSyncMetrics::CountRegisterSuccess(
BackgroundSyncType::PERIODIC,
/* min_interval_ms= */ 1000,
BackgroundSyncMetrics::REGISTRATION_COULD_FIRE,
/* registration_is_duplicate= */
BackgroundSyncMetrics::REGISTRATION_IS_DUPLICATE);
histogram_tester_.ExpectUniqueSample(
"BackgroundSync.Registration.Periodic.MinInterval", 1, 1);
histogram_tester_.ExpectUniqueSample("BackgroundSync.Registration.Periodic",
BACKGROUND_SYNC_STATUS_OK, 1);
histogram_tester_.ExpectUniqueSample(
"BackgroundSync.Registration.Periodic.IsDuplicate", 1, 1);
}
TEST_F(BackgroundSyncMetricsTest, CountUnregisterPeriodicSync) {
BackgroundSyncMetrics::CountUnregisterPeriodicSync(BACKGROUND_SYNC_STATUS_OK);
histogram_tester_.ExpectUniqueSample("BackgroundSync.Unregistration.Periodic",
BACKGROUND_SYNC_STATUS_OK, 1);
}
TEST_F(BackgroundSyncMetricsTest, EventsFiredFromWakeupTask) {
BackgroundSyncMetrics::RecordEventsFiredFromWakeupTask(
BackgroundSyncType::ONE_SHOT,
/* events_fired= */ false);
histogram_tester_.ExpectBucketCount(
"BackgroundSync.WakeupTaskFiredEvents.OneShot", false, 1);
BackgroundSyncMetrics::RecordEventsFiredFromWakeupTask(
BackgroundSyncType::PERIODIC,
/* events_fired= */ true);
histogram_tester_.ExpectBucketCount(
"BackgroundSync.WakeupTaskFiredEvents.Periodic", true, 1);
}
} // namespace content
